Hi there,

 

I wondered if someone could help?

I signed a "Assured Shorthold Tenancy Agreement" on the 26th of April and it states it runs until the 4th November.

 

However, I have now been requested to move by my company and take a new position. With that said they are not willing to pay any costs so I wondered how I can go about terminating my lease agreement and what financial penalties I will incur?

 

I paid a £700 deposit, will i just lose that or will I also have to pay the rent until the end of the lease or until they re-let.

 

Please can someone clear this up for me?!

You could potentially(and you have to work on the basis of probably) be liable for the entirety of the rent up until the end of the lease.
